Revolutionizing Healthcare through AI

Texas has become a leading state in the adoption of artificial intelligence technologies, especially in the healthcare sector. One of the most notable implementations is by a major hospital in Houston, which integrated AI to optimize patient care. Through predictive analytics, the hospital can now anticipate patient needs and allocate resources more efficiently. This has resulted in reduced wait times and improved patient satisfaction.

Another example is the use of AI for diagnostics. In Dallas, a healthcare startup has developed an AI system that assists doctors in diagnosing diseases with greater accuracy. By analyzing medical images and patient data, the system provides insights that are sometimes missed by human eyes, leading to earlier and more accurate diagnoses.

AI in Agriculture: Boosting Productivity

Agriculture is another industry in Texas benefiting from AI. Farms across the state are using AI-powered drones and sensors to monitor crop health. These technologies provide real-time data on soil conditions, moisture levels, and crop growth, allowing farmers to make informed decisions about irrigation and fertilization.

Moreover, AI-driven machinery has automated various farming processes, significantly increasing productivity. For instance, in the Rio Grande Valley, AI systems are being used to predict weather patterns and optimize planting schedules, ensuring better yields and less waste.

Transforming the Energy Sector

The energy sector in Texas is also seeing significant advancements due to AI. Oil and gas companies are employing AI for predictive maintenance of machinery, reducing downtime and saving costs. By analyzing data from equipment sensors, AI can predict failures before they occur, allowing for timely maintenance.

Furthermore, AI is being used to enhance renewable energy production. Wind farms in West Texas are utilizing AI to analyze wind patterns and optimize turbine operations, resulting in a more efficient energy production process.

Enhancing Transportation and Logistics

Transportation and logistics companies in Texas are leveraging AI to streamline operations. In Austin, a leading logistics company has implemented AI tools to optimize delivery routes. This technology uses real-time traffic data to minimize delivery times and reduce fuel consumption.

Self-driving vehicles are also being tested on Texas roads. These autonomous vehicles are equipped with advanced AI systems that enhance safety and efficiency. The data collected from these tests is invaluable for future developments in autonomous transportation.

The Impact on Education

AI is making waves in the education sector as well. Schools across Texas are adopting AI-based platforms to personalize learning experiences for students. These platforms adapt the curriculum based on individual learning paces and preferences, ensuring that each student receives an education tailored to their needs.

Additionally, AI is being used to automate administrative tasks within educational institutions, freeing up valuable time for teachers and staff to focus on student engagement and instruction.
